A suspect who jumped into a canal to evade the police was caught out ... after leaving a trail of water behind him. Greater Manchester Police shared the images of a watery trial that was left behind after a male suspect had jumped into the canal in the city centre in an attempt to escape.
Through following the trail and using local CCTV footage, officers eventually traced the suspect. The force did not specify what the male was wanted for.
